Huntington sued over defective sidewalk

HUNTINGTON - A Cabell County man has filed suit against the city of Huntington for falling on a sidewalk after leaving a fast food restaurant.

According to the suit filed Sept. 6 in Cabell Circuit Court, Lewis was leaving the McDonald's on Washington Avenue after eating breakfast when he fell on broken pavement on the sidewalk.

"The sidewalk was broken, portions projecting upward and downward with grass growing in the defective portions," the suit says.

Lewis claims the fall caused broken facial bones, fractured teeth, lacerations, contusions and abrasions of his body and extremities.

According to the suit, Lewis suffered a loss of enjoyment of life, emotional distress and shame at his facial appearance. He seeks compensatory and punitive damages.

Attorney James E. Spurlock is representing Lewis. The case has been assigned to Judge John L. Cummings.

Cabell Circuit Court case number 07-C-784
